It is with heavy hearts that we announce the passing of our beloved Pastor Noel Shanko. Pastor Shanko fell asleep in Jesus on Tuesday, August 4, 2026.
For more than 40 years, Pastor Shanko faithfully served the Lord in the Potomac, Carolina, and Florida Conferences. Throughout his ministry, he served in many roles, including pastor, Ministerial Director, and Assistant to the President. No matter the title, his calling remained the same—to faithfully shepherd God’s people and lead others into a deeper relationship with Jesus.
Pastor Shanko‘s life was a testimony of humble service, unwavering faith, and a genuine love for people. He had a remarkable way of encouraging those around him, caring deeply for fellow workers and church members alike, and reminding us that our greatest work is preparing people for the soon return of Jesus. While only eternity will reveal the full impact of his ministry, we know that countless lives were touched because he answered God’s call with faithfulness.
Today, we mourn the loss of a faithful pastor, trusted colleague, and dear friend. Our hearts ache alongside his family and all who had the privilege of knowing him. Yet we grieve with hope, because our confidence rests not in this life, but in the promise of the resurrection.
